N Position Type Non-Management Position Summary The Assistant F&B Marketing Manager is responsible for developing and executing strategic marketing initiatives for all F&B outlets at JW Marriott Marquis Dubai. Reporting to the F&B Marketing Manager, this role oversees marketing calendars, ensures seamless campaign execution, and drives outlet-specific positioning through tailored annual marketing plans. The position plays a key role in shaping F&B brand strategies, launch concepts, and promotional frameworks that enhance guest engagement and revenue. The role manages social media channels, supports content creation, and coordinates cross-functional stakeholders to deliver impactful, on-brand storytelling across all F&B touchpoints within the property.
